In a strategic move that reverberates throughout the global esports ecosystem, Lee “Faker” Sang-hyeok, universally acknowledged as the preeminent player in League of Legends history, has officially extended his contract with South Korean powerhouse T1. This landmark agreement ensures the iconic mid-laner`s continued presence with the organization until 2029, cementing a partnership that has now flourished for over a decade and exhibits no discernible intent of concluding.
A Commitment Unlike Any Other
Faker`s preceding contract was slated to conclude on November 17, 2025, coincident with the culmination of the 2025 World Championship and the subsequent transfer window. T1`s proactive decision to prolong this agreement for an additional four years stands as a profound organizational declaration. It solidifies Faker`s position not merely as a formidable player, but as an indispensable cornerstone of the T1 franchise. In a competitive landscape characterized by frequent player roster adjustments, such a protracted commitment is exceptionally uncommon, underscoring both Faker`s invaluable contribution and the deep-seated mutual trust between the player and his long-standing team.
The Undisputed Monarch of the Rift
Since his professional debut in 2013, and his subsequent joining of T1 (then SK Telecom T1) in 2014, Faker has maintained exclusive affiliation with this single organization. This unprecedented loyalty, synergized with his unparalleled skill, has forged a legacy that remains singularly unmatched. His career narrative is a testament to consistent innovation and record-breaking achievements, culminating in a competitive résumé that serves as the aspirational benchmark for emerging esports professionals. In 2024, he secured his fifth League of Legends World Championship title, an accomplishment that irrefutably affirms his enduring dominance and remarkable adaptability within a continuously evolving game environment.
Beyond the sheer quantitative measure of championships, Faker holds unique distinctions that further amplify his legendary stature:
- He is the sole player in the history of the League of Legends World Championship to secure back-to-back titles, a feat demanding sustained peak performance and exceptional team cohesion.
- He holds the distinction of being the first player in League of Legends esports to accumulate 200 victories in international tournaments, a statistic that emphatically highlights his consistent presence and impact at the pinnacle of global competition.
